Variation of surface ozone exceedance around Klang Valley, Malaysia

The total hourly surface ozone (O-3) exceedance from the 100 ppbv hourly O-3 standard set by the Department of Environment Malaysia (DOE) was analysed, as elevated O-3 concentrations pose health risks to humans and harms vegetation. Air quality data from 2008 to 2010 were obtained from a total of seven stations located around the west coast of Peninsular Malaysia. Cheras and Shah Alam monitoring stations consistently showed a high frequency of noncompliance to the DOE standards. Hierarchical Agglomerative Cluster Analysis (HACA) was performed on the daily maximum O-3 concentration to analyse the spatial variability. Three distinct clusters were obtained from HACA runs on the daily maximum O-3 and the results reflected O-3 exceedance pattern among the stations. Analysis of the monthly average O-3, nitrogen oxide (NO), and nitrogen dioxide (NO2) concentrations indicated a strong localised influence on the O-3 exceedance patterns. It can be concluded that the O-3 exceedance pattern in the Klang Valley area is strongly influenced by local pollutant emission and dispersion characteristics. (C) 2014 Elsevier B.V.
